Solution for (7x-14)+(4x-1)=180 equation:


Simplifying
(7x + -14) + (4x + -1) = 180

Reorder the terms:
(-14 + 7x) + (4x + -1) = 180

Remove parenthesis around (-14 + 7x)
-14 + 7x + (4x + -1) = 180

Reorder the terms:
-14 + 7x + (-1 + 4x) = 180

Remove parenthesis around (-1 + 4x)
-14 + 7x + -1 + 4x = 180

Reorder the terms:
-14 + -1 + 7x + 4x = 180

Combine like terms: -14 + -1 = -15
-15 + 7x + 4x = 180

Combine like terms: 7x + 4x = 11x
-15 + 11x = 180

Solving
-15 + 11x = 180

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'15' to each side of the equation.
-15 + 15 + 11x = 180 + 15

Combine like terms: -15 + 15 = 0
0 + 11x = 180 + 15
11x = 180 + 15

Combine like terms: 180 + 15 = 195
11x = 195

Divide each side by '11'.
x = 17.72727273

Simplifying
x = 17.72727273
